ALFRED, N.Y. -- Despite a pair of hard-fought battles at No. 3 doubles and No. 2 singles, the Elmira College women's tennis team was beaten, 7-2, by Alfred University in the 2018-19 Empire 8 Conference opener on Wednesday at Alfred's William T. Brown Tennis Courts.
The Soaring Eagles secured two points by earning one win apiece in doubles and singles play, with both matches requiring a tiebreaker set. The duo of
Katy Jewett '21 and
Marta Kliszcz '20 were victors at third doubles against AU's Rachel Pera and Miranda Sakala. With the score even at 7-all, the Soaring Eagles posted a 7-3 score in the tiebreaker to seal the match, 8-7.
Alfred solidified the match and improved to 1-0 in E8 play by earning wins in fourth of the five singles matchups. In the second spot in the lineup, sophomore
Cassie Brown '21 endured a grueling three-set match versus Alfred's Lauren Boshart. The EC sophomore took the opening set, 6-4, and rebounded from a 6-1 loss in the second set by cruising to a 10-3 triumph in the super tiebreaker.
Senior
Cheyanne Holwell '19 put up a tough fight at No. 3 singles for the Soaring Eagles but fell in straight sets by identical 6-2 scores. Following her doubles win, Kliszcz tested Alfred's Amber Smith at the fifth singles position by taking three games in the second set, but it wasn't enough, as Smith prevailed by a 6-0, 6-3 final.
